Nested Phoenix is a research project aimed at delivering the next generation engine for an integrated life cycle assessment and material stocks and flows analysis of the built environment. Nested Phoenix uses a bottom-up approach to model the built environment, from door handles, to window frames, to partition walls, structure, sidewalks, squares, parks, neighbourhoods and cities. Coupled to geographical information systems, Nested Phoenix enables a spatialised LCA and MFA of a built stock at unprecedented resolution. Nested Phoenix will enable decision-making related to retrofitting, urban mining, urban design and planning and the circular economy.
